C# Класс MigSharp.Process.History

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
Delete ( long timestamp, string moduleName ) : void
GetMigrations ( ) : IEnumerable
History ( TableName tableName, IProviderMetadata providerMetadata ) : System
Insert ( long timestamp, string moduleName, string tag ) : void
Load ( IDbConnection connection, IDbTransaction transaction ) : void
Store ( IDbConnection connection, IDbTransaction transaction, IDbCommandExecutor executor ) : void

Приватные методы

Метод Описание
Escape ( TableName tableName ) : string
LoadEntry ( long timestamp, string moduleName, string tag ) : void

Описание методов

Delete() публичный Метод

public Delete ( long timestamp, string moduleName ) : void
timestamp long
moduleName string
Результат void

GetMigrations() публичный Метод

public GetMigrations ( ) : IEnumerable
Результат IEnumerable

History() публичный Метод

public History ( TableName tableName, IProviderMetadata providerMetadata ) : System
tableName MigSharp.Core.TableName
providerMetadata IProviderMetadata
Результат System

Insert() публичный Метод

public Insert ( long timestamp, string moduleName, string tag ) : void
timestamp long
moduleName string
tag string
Результат void

Load() публичный Метод

public Load ( IDbConnection connection, IDbTransaction transaction ) : void
connection IDbConnection
transaction IDbTransaction
Результат void

Store() публичный Метод

public Store ( IDbConnection connection, IDbTransaction transaction, IDbCommandExecutor executor ) : void
connection IDbConnection
transaction IDbTransaction
executor IDbCommandExecutor
Результат void